What “Timer Terms” Actually Mean
Here is the deal: a timer term is a clause that forces you to meet wagering requirements before the clock hits zero. Miss the deadline and the bonus evaporates, leaving you with nothing but a sore thumb and an empty wallet.
Typical Time Frames
Some sites give you 24 hours, others hand you a whole week. The sweet spot? A 48-hour window that feels generous but still pressures you into action. Anything longer is usually a bait-and-switch, padded with hidden conditions.

Common Pitfalls That Kill Your Bonus
First, ignoring the “must play” clause. You think you can sit on a free spin, but the timer keeps marching, and the casino counts idle time as a loss. Second, overlooking game contribution ratios. Slots may count 100%, roulette 10%, and that’s why you see your balance flatlining despite a flurry of spins.

Strategic Playbook
Step one: read the fine print. If a bonus says “24-hour play window,” assume it means “24-hour window from the moment you accept.” Step two: pick games with 100% contribution. Step three: set a timer on your phone to remind you when the clock is at 10-minute warning. Step four: cash out the moment you hit the wagering target — don’t wait for the bonus to disappear.
